#b476a5 h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#b476a5 is composed of 70.6% red, 46.3% green and 64.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.4% magenta, 8.3%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 314.5 degrees, a saturation of 29.2% and a lightness of 58.4%. #b476a5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ffecff with #69004b.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#f9f5f8 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c8e98 is the less saturated color, while #fd2dcb is the most saturated one.
